For the first 40 books or so, Jake always gets books X1 and X6 Rachel gets X2 and X7, Tobias gets X3, Cassie gets X4 and X9, Marco gets books X5 and X0, and a character you haven't met yet gets book X8... Scholastic Books felt readers wouldn't connect with Tobias and the other character as much, because Tobias is stuck in hawk form, and spoilers spoilers spoilers...
Around book 40, the error was corrected, and all 6 characters were given even representation in POV books (too little, too late, really, so close to the end...

There's 54 animorphs regular books, 4 Megamorphs (multi-POV books with "bigger" plots), and 4 Chronicles, which fill in backstory and info on other alien races/characters of the series...
I think they all have official ebooks these days, but the publishers also allow the sharing of the fan-made ebooks from the Dark Times before official ebooks were released, due to the labor of love aspect of it all...
